The Formation Principle of Transparency Gelatin. Transparency refers to the ability of a dissolved gelatin solution or gel to transmit light, and it is an important indicator of gelatin purity and quality. Higher transparency indicates fewer impurities (such as insoluble particles, pigments, ash, etc.) and a more uniform molecular structure.

Molecular Structure Characteristics

 

Gelatin is obtained from the partial hydrolysis of collagen. Its molecular chains have a triple helix structure (partially retained) or a randomly coiled state. This structure allows light to pass through with lower scattering intensity, thus forming a transparent or translucent state.

Gelatin with a uniform molecular weight distribution and low impurity content is more likely to form highly transparent solutions or gels.

 

Influence of Solution State

  • Concentration: Low-concentration gelatin solutions (e.g., 1%-5%) are generally more transparent. Increasing the concentration may cause the solution to become cloudy (due to enhanced intermolecular interactions).
  • Temperature: Heating a dissolved gelatin solution results in higher transparency. After cooling and forming a gel, the transparency may decrease slightly (due to slight scattering caused by the ordered molecular arrangement).
  • pH value: Gelatin is most stable and has the highest transparency under neutral conditions (pH 5-7); acidic or alkaline environments may cause molecular hydrolysis or aggregation, reducing transparency.
